Description

About four to five thousand years ago, the fertile plains of the Yellow River basin gave rise to Chinese civilization. Over the millennia, this civilization evolved into one of the world’s great cultures. This book offers a quick introduction to China, with the main focus on its long history. Readers are guided through the dynasties and the major developments shaping China’s arts, culture, philosophy, religion, language and literature. Spanning five millennia, the book covers myths, legends, traditional Chinese medicine, and more. This compact 200-page volume condenses five millennia of Chinese history and civilization into an accessible overview that goes beyond dates and names.
